What does a Goodwill employee do?

Goodwill employees work for Goodwill Industries, a nonprofit organization that provides job training, employment placement services, and other community-based programs for people facing challenges to finding employment. Employees may work in retail stores, donation centers, warehouses, or administrative offices. Their roles can include sorting donations, assisting customers, running cash registers, managing inventory, or supporting job training programs. Goodwill aims to create employment opportunities and strengthen communities through the power of work.

What are typical career advancement opportunities for employees working at Goodwill stores?

Employees at Goodwill stores often have clear paths for career growth, starting with entry-level retail positions and progressing to supervisory or management roles. Goodwill is known for promoting from within and offers training programs to help employees develop leadership and operational skills. Many team members advance to roles such as shift leader, assistant manager, and store manager, while others may transition into specialized positions in logistics, human resources, or vocational training. The organization values dedication and a strong work ethic, making it a supportive environment for professional development.

Job description

Material Handler

The Material Handler unloads donations from containers and moves goods to appropriate production areas.

Pay Rate: $21.30/hour

Work Environment: Outdoors and warehouse environment, temperature varies, exposure to dust.

Essential Functions and Responsibilities:

  • Remove and sort through salvage material and garbage from salable goods.
  • Sort donations into appropriate bins for further processing.
  • Provide a smooth flow of goods to the production floor.
  • Use cardboard compactors and identify problems.
  • Maintain donor tallies.
  • Maintain a clean work environment.
  • Demonstrate safe work practices through awareness and observation in support of a safety culture and report any potential hazards or accidents.
  • Build and maintain internal and external customer satisfaction.
  • If applicable: Consistent and safe execution of duties associated with forklift operation when certified to Seattle Goodwill standards.
  • Minors: Are not allowed to use or perform any job duties with any heavy machinery or compactors.
  • Maintain reliable attendance.
  • Able to communicate with others effectively both verbally and written, including those who have limited English skills.

Other duties, responsibilities, and activities may change or be assigned at any time with or without notice.

Education and Experience:

  • High school graduate or equivalency preferred, but not required
  • No experience required
  • Applicants must be 18 years or older

Certificates, Licenses, or Registrations:

If applicable to job role: Seattle Goodwill Forklift certification optional, must meet eligibility requirements

Physical Abilities:

While performing the duties of this job, the employee will be required to lift and carry up to 30-40 pounds; have developed fine motor control (grasp, handle, manipulate objects with fingers; standing for long periods, frequent bending, kneeling, reaching, stooping, squatting, pushing; climbing ladders; able to travel across a variety of surfaces (stairs, ramps, uneven terrain).

Essential Mental/Sensory Abilities :

  • Organizing, sorting, categorizing, counting, adding, subtracting
  • Problem Solving
  • Communicating with the public
  • Verbal and written communication skills
